Chromecast guest mode

How does guest mode work?

When guest mode is turned on, Chromecast emits a special Wi-Fi and Bluetooth beacon. When a Chromecast-enabled app is launched on your guest's mobile device, that device detects the presence of the special Wi-Fi or Bluetooth beacon and shows the Cast icon in the application. Upon tapping the Cast icon, casting to a "Nearby Device" will be listed as an available option.

Your Chromecast then generates a random 4-digit PIN that is required to cast to it using guest mode. When a device nearby tries to connect, the Chromecast automatically transfers that PIN using short, inaudible audio tones. If the audio tone pairing fails, your guest will be given the option to connect manually by entering the 4-digit PIN found on your Chromecast Ambient mode screen and in the Google Home app.
